How It Works with a Medical Malpractice Lawyer
Knowing the path forward can give you clarity as you begin your claim. Here is the general sequence of events when you work with a medical malpractice lawyer at Simmrin Law Group:
- Free Initial Consultation — Our attorneys meet with you to hear your story, look at initial evidence you can share, and give you an honest assessment of the strength of your case.
- Medical Record Collection and Review — We collect and analyze your complete medical records from every relevant provider, then analyze them for evidence of error.
- Retaining Independent Medical Reviewers — We consult board-certified medical experts in the applicable specialty to confirm that the standard of care was violated.
- Launching Formal Action — When the foundation is established, we file the necessary legal documents, serve the defendant, and open the legal case.
- Exchanging Evidence — All parties involved share documentation and record testimony from relevant medical staff. This phase frequently reveals additional support for your claim.
- Negotiation and Settlement Discussions — Most cases settle before trial. We push hard for a settlement that reflects the full scope of your losses.
- Going to Court When Necessary — If a reasonable offer is not made, our courtroom advocates argue on your behalf before a court with confidence.

How can I tell if my doctor's mistake rises to the level of malpractice?Not all bad outcome amounts to malpractice. To pursue a case, you typically must establish four things: there was a duty of care, the provider deviated from the accepted medical standard, that the failure directly led to your damages, and that real, measurable damages resulted. What is the timeline for resolving a malpractice claim?Medical malpractice claims tend to be the most time-consuming in personal injury law. Matters with clear-cut evidence may conclude in 12 to 18 months, while disputes requiring trial can extend well beyond two years. Variables including the availability of expert witnesses all affect the duration.
What is the statute of limitations for medical malpractice in California?In California, the statute of limitations for medical malpractice stands at three years from when the harm occurred or one year from when you reasonably should have known about the injury, depending on which occurs sooner. Special rules apply for minors. Time is critical — failing to file in time eliminates your ability to sue.
What types of damages can I recover in a medical malpractice case?Victims may be entitled to several categories of damages in a successful malpractice claim. These generally cover past and future medical expenses, diminished future earnings, physical discomfort and emotional distress, and when conduct was especially egregious, you could receive punitive compensation as well. California places limits on non-economic damages in malpractice cases, which is another reason to have a knowledgeable medical malpractice lawyer on your side.
